The control plane exposes a REST API and (post-v0.5) a gRPC service.
Both speak the same pg_hardstorage.v1 schema as the CLI's JSON
output. The control plane itself ships in v0.5 — what's documented
here is the contract that v0.1 binaries are built to honour.
OpenAPI 3.1 spec: api/openapi.yaml (will be filled in fully in
v0.5; the contracts below are stable).
All routes live under /v1/. The v1 major version commits to a
24-month backward-compatibility window: a script written
against v1 in 2026 keeps working through 2028. New fields may
appear; existing fields don't change shape; existing routes don't
change semantics.
When a breaking change is unavoidable, /v2/ is added alongside
/v1/; clients migrate at their own pace.
Two mechanisms, composable:
- mTLS. Client presents a certificate signed by the control
plane's CA. Identity = the certificate Subject's
CN. - Bearer tokens.
Authorization: Bearer <token>. Tokens are issued by the control plane (or a configured OIDC provider) and scoped to RBAC verbs.
Default-deny: a request that authenticates but lacks the required
verb returns 403 Forbidden with a structured error.code of
authz.denied.
RBAC verbs include backup:create, backup:read,
restore:execute, kms:rotate, kms:shred, audit:read,
admin:*. Verbs are tenant-scoped.
All responses are wrapped:
{
"schema": "pg_hardstorage.v1",
"command": "backups.list",
"generated_at": "2026-04-29T14:21:08Z",
"result": {
"body": { "...route-specific..." }
}
}Errors use the same wrapper with error instead of result:
{
"schema": "pg_hardstorage.v1",
"error": {
"code": "wal.slot_missing",
"message": "Replication slot 'pg_hardstorage_db1' not present.",
"subject": { "deployment": "db1" },
"suggestion": {
"human": "Recreate the slot.",
"command": "pg_hardstorage wal repair db1",
"doc_url": "https://docs.pghardstorage.org/runbooks/wal-slot-missing"
}
}
}HTTP status codes map to the CLI exit-code contract:
| HTTP | CLI exit | Meaning |
|---|---|---|
| 200 | 0 | Success |
| 400 | 2 | Misuse / bad request |
| 401 | 3 | Auth required |
| 403 | 3 | Auth denied |
| 404 | 6 | Not found |
| 409 | 7 | Conflict |
| 412 | 4 | Pre-flight failed |
| 422 | 9 | Verify failure |
| 503 | 8 | Storage / KMS unreachable |
| 500 | 1 | Generic error |

POST /backups returns a streaming NDJSON body — one event per
line, same schema the CLI emits with -o ndjson. Final event is
backup_completed (or an error frame).
POST /v1/deployments/{d}/restores # initiate; streams NDJSON progress
GET /v1/deployments/{d}/restores/{id} # status
Request body for POST /restores:
{
"backup_id": "db1.full.20260427T093017Z",
"target": "/var/lib/postgresql/restored",
"to": "5 minutes ago", // or "to_lsn": "0/3000028", "to_name": "..."
"verify": "auto", // auto | skip | require
"force": false
}The pre-flight refusals (target non-empty, KMS unreachable, Patroni
primary, etc.) return 412 Precondition Failed with the same
Suggestion shape as the CLI.

Backup, restore, verify, and WAL stream return chunked NDJSON. Each
line is a typed Event:
{"schema":"pg_hardstorage.v1","severity_name":"info","op":"backup_started","subject":{"deployment":"db1","backup_id":"..."}}
{"schema":"pg_hardstorage.v1","severity_name":"info","op":"progress","body":{"bytes_logical":4194304000,"bytes_physical":1342177280,"dedup_ratio":3.12,"throughput_mb_s":620}}
{"schema":"pg_hardstorage.v1","severity_name":"warning","op":"chunker_paused","body":{"reason":"backpressure","stage":"storage_put"}}
{"schema":"pg_hardstorage.v1","severity_name":"notice","op":"backup_completed","body":{"verified":true,"duration_seconds":847}}The same payload reaches every configured Sink concurrently — your Slack webhook, your Jira board, and the API consumer see the same event.
A streaming endpoint that fails mid-stream emits a final error
frame and closes the connection without a trailing newline; clients
should handle EOF followed by an error frame as a normal failure.
